Fix dhcp-forwarder build, move init-script to ./files/
authornico <nico@3c298f89-4303-0410-b956-a3cf2f4a3e73>
Sun, 15 May 2005 13:04:57 +0000 (13:04 +0000)
committernico <nico@3c298f89-4303-0410-b956-a3cf2f4a3e73>
Sun, 15 May 2005 13:04:57 +0000 (13:04 +0000)
git-svn-id: svn://svn.openwrt.org/openwrt/trunk/openwrt@909 3c298f89-4303-0410-b956-a3cf2f4a3e73

package/Makefile
package/dhcp-forwarder/Config.in
package/dhcp-forwarder/Makefile
package/dhcp-forwarder/files/dhcp-fwd.init [new file with mode: 0644]
package/dhcp-forwarder/ipkg/dhcp-forwarder.init [deleted file]

index 7fc50c1..872489f 100644 (file)
@@ -74,7 +74,7 @@ package-$(BR2_PACKAGE_USBUTILS) += usbutils
 package-$(BR2_PACKAGE_WIRELESS_TOOLS) += wireless-tools
 package-$(BR2_PACKAGE_WOL) += wol
 package-$(BR2_PACKAGE_ZLIB) += zlib
-package-$(BR2_PACKAGE_DHCPFWD) += dhcp-forwarder
+package-$(BR2_PACKAGE_DHCP_FORWARDER) += dhcp-forwarder
 package-$(BR2_PACKAGE_LIBGD) += libgd
 package-$(BR2_PACKAGE_LIBNET) += libnet
 package-$(BR2_PACKAGE_LIBMYSQLCLIENT) += mysql
index 34ff1c0..7cddf97 100644 (file)
@@ -1,5 +1,5 @@
 config BR2_PACKAGE_DHCP_FORWARDER
-       tristate "dhcp-forwarder (a DHCP relay agent)"
+       tristate "dhcp-forwarder - a DHCP relay agent"
        default m if CONFIG_DEVEL
        help
          A DHCP relay agent
index 7b9f238..7da1928 100644 (file)
@@ -56,10 +56,10 @@ $(PKG_BUILD_DIR)/.built:
        touch $(PKG_BUILD_DIR)/.built
        
 $(IPKG_DHCP_FORWARDER):
-       install -m0755 -d $(IDIR_DHCP_FORWARDER)/etc/init.d
-       install -m0755 ./ipkg/$(PKG_NAME).init $(IDIR_DHCP_FORWARDER)/etc/init.d/dhcp-fwd
        install -m0755 -d $(IDIR_DHCP_FORWARDER)/etc
        install -m0644 $(PKG_BUILD_DIR)/contrib/dhcp-fwd.conf $(IDIR_DHCP_FORWARDER)/etc/
+       install -m0755 -d $(IDIR_DHCP_FORWARDER)/etc/init.d
+       install -m0755 ./files/dhcp-fwd.init $(IDIR_DHCP_FORWARDER)/etc/init.d/dhcp-fwd
        install -m0755 -d $(IDIR_DHCP_FORWARDER)/usr/bin
        cp -fpR $(PKG_INSTALL_DIR)/usr/sbin/dhcp-fwd $(IDIR_DHCP_FORWARDER)/usr/bin/
        $(RSTRIP) $(IDIR_DHCP_FORWARDER)
diff --git a/package/dhcp-forwarder/files/dhcp-fwd.init b/package/dhcp-forwarder/files/dhcp-fwd.init
new file mode 100644 (file)
index 0000000..6ad3858
--- /dev/null
@@ -0,0 +1,21 @@
+#!/bin/sh
+
+LOG_D=/var/log
+RUN_D=/var/run
+PID_F=$RUN_D/dhcpd-fwd.pid
+
+case $1 in
+ start)
+  [ -d $LOG_D ] || mkdir -p $LOG_D
+  [ -d $RUN_D ] || mkdir -p $RUN_D
+  dhcp-fwd
+  ;;
+ stop)
+  [ -f $PID_F ] && kill $(cat $PID_F)
+  ;;
+ *)
+  echo "usage: $0 (start|stop)"
+  exit 1
+esac
+
+exit $?
diff --git a/package/dhcp-forwarder/ipkg/dhcp-forwarder.init b/package/dhcp-forwarder/ipkg/dhcp-forwarder.init
deleted file mode 100644 (file)
index 6ad3858..0000000
+++ /dev/null
@@ -1,21 +0,0 @@
-#!/bin/sh
-
-LOG_D=/var/log
-RUN_D=/var/run
-PID_F=$RUN_D/dhcpd-fwd.pid
-
-case $1 in
- start)
-  [ -d $LOG_D ] || mkdir -p $LOG_D
-  [ -d $RUN_D ] || mkdir -p $RUN_D
-  dhcp-fwd
-  ;;
- stop)
-  [ -f $PID_F ] && kill $(cat $PID_F)
-  ;;
- *)
-  echo "usage: $0 (start|stop)"
-  exit 1
-esac
-
-exit $?